Jaime Lyndon Yaneza, senior anti-virus consultant with Trend Micro Philippines, offers the following tips to keep your computer virus-free:

1)    It is no longer true that you can safely read e-mail if we don’t open attachments. If the source is unknown and appears suspicious, delete it. If we know the sender but are still suspicious, send a massage verifying that the person really sent it.
2)    Never open files with more that one file extension (such as Ricky Martin.JPG.VBS). There is no reason for multiple extensions.
3)    Don’t use pirated software, which can carry viruses.
4)    Load anti-virus software into your system and use it to scan all desks you put into your computer or files that you download. Norton (Norton.com) and McAfee (McAfee.com) offer trial software, and Trend Micro have a free online virus scanning service at http://housecall.antivirus.com.
5)    Save Microsoft World files in rich text format (.rtf) instead of as.doc files. This strips off any macro virus that could have infected the documents.
